Check-Mate Shoes Ltd.

Comments on Check-Mate Shoes Ltd.. 173-5005 dalhousie dr nw, Calgary T3A5R8 AB
Please share as much information as you can about Check-Mate Shoes Ltd. so other users can benefit from your comment.
Can't read?